1,2,4,5-Tetramethylbenzene Global Industrial Status

1,2,4,5-Tetramethylbenzene, commonly referred to as Durene (CAS No. 95-93-2), represents a fundamental chemical building block in modern specialty polymer fabrication and organic synthesis. With its highly symmetric alkyl aromatic structure, it is the primary precursor for the synthesis of Pyromellitic Dianhydride (PMDA), which in turn acts as the cornerstone monomer for high-performance polyimide (PI) films, aerospace coatings, and high-temperature-resistant engineered plastics.

On a global scale, the demand for high-purity 1,2,4,5-Tetramethylbenzene continues to escalate, driven by the expansion of the electronics manufacturing sector, structural aerospace engineering projects, and specialty curing agents. Chemical Property / Parameter Technical Value Specification
Chemical Name 1,2,4,5-Tetramethylbenzene (Durene)
CAS Registry Number 95-93-2
Molecular Formula C10H14
Appearance White Crystalline Powder / Solid flakes
Melting Point Range 79.2 °C to 81.5 °C
Boiling Point 196.8 °C (760 mmHg)
Purity (GC analysis) ≥ 98.5% / ≥ 99.0% / ≥ 99.5%

Specialized Industrial & Commercial Applications

1,2,4,5-Tetramethylbenzene is utilized across several critical modern manufacturing chains.

High-Performance Polyimides (PI)

Durene serves as the chemical backbone for Pyromellitic Dianhydride (PMDA). PMDA is processed into high-temperature polyimide films, which are critical for flexible printed circuits (FPC), aerospace wire insulation, and semiconductor substrate coatings.

Specialty Coating Curing Agents

Derivatives of 1,2,4,5-tetramethylbenzene act as non-yellowing, weather-resistant curing components in polyurethane and epoxy formulations. These are widely utilized in heavy-duty automotive, marine, and industrial structural coatings.

Agricultural Intermediates & Synthetics

Certain halogenated and nitrated derivatives of Durene are critical intermediates for high-selectivity herbicides, crop protection agents, and organic pigments, offering high thermal stability and performance profiles.
